3 year rule

Then everything proving bonafide marriage, such as:

 

- Tax return transcripts showing you filed taxes jointly

- Joint lease(s) and or mortgage statements

- Utility bills in both names

- Joint bank account statements

- Copies of IDs / DLs showing same address

- Birth certificates of any children born in this marriage

- Flight and hotel reservations showing both names

- Receipts for big purchases showing both names

- Car and/or health insurance policies showing both names

- Wills listing spouses

- Printouts of retirement plans / brokerage accounts showing spouse is listed as beneficiary

- Affidavits from friends and family

- Joint memberships

- Many more

Going back 3 years? It was just sent with i751 a year ago

Depends on your comfort level. There's been cases when officer said "We don't have your I-751 file" or "We don't have enough evidence", e.g sometimes USCIS loses evidence. If you bring everything, you'll be bulletproof. 

At the same time, you may be never asked for much evidence going back.
